Renders a single fiber::streamline as an interactive 3D line plot. See plot3d() for the full parameter documentation and examples.

Arguments

x

A fiber::streamline object.

color

Controls how streamline colours are assigned. Accepted values:

  • "orientation" (default): per-point RGB colour derived from the local fibre direction. The absolute values of the normalised tangent vector \((|dx|, |dy|, |dz|)\) are mapped to the R, G, B channels — the standard DTI colour convention (left-right = red, anterior-posterior = green, superior-inferior = blue).

  • A metadata key: a string matching a key in @point_data (per-point scalar) or @streamline_data (per-streamline scalar, broadcast to all points). Numeric values are mapped to a continuous colour scale (palette); character values are coloured categorically.

  • A CSS/hex colour string: e.g. "#E69F00" or "steelblue". All lines are drawn in that fixed colour.

palette

A plotly / ColorBrewer colour scale name applied when color is a numeric metadata key. Defaults to "Viridis".

linewidth

Numeric. Width of the plotted lines. Defaults to 2.

opacity

Numeric in [0, 1]. Global line opacity. Defaults to 0.5.

...

Additional named arguments forwarded to plotly::layout(), e.g. title = "My bundle".

Value

An interactive plotly htmlwidget.
